The Plot: Michael Jai White stars as Isaiah Bone, an elite martial artist recently paroled from prison. He enters the underground bare-knuckle fighting scene in Los Angeles to fulfill a promise to a deceased friend.
Action Quality: The fight choreography is highly praised for its "real, gritty, R-rated, street-level violence". Fans often highlight White's "raw, thunderous power" and technical skill, noting it as his most iconic role.
Critique: While the story is considered "clichéd" or "by the numbers" by some critics, the superb execution of the action sequences makes it a "must-watch" for martial arts enthusiasts. Status of Blood and Bone 2 (2026)

Synopsis
In Los Angeles, an ex-con named Isaiah Bone (Michael Jai White) arrives with a mysterious past and a single goal: to honor a promise to his dead friend’s wife. He quickly becomes entangled in the underground street-fighting circuit run by a ruthless crime boss, James (Julian Sands). Using his unparalleled martial arts skills, Bone fights his way up from back-alley brawls to high-stakes matches, all while protecting a young woman from a human trafficker.
Verdict (Legit Viewing)
Rating: 7/10
Blood and Bone is a top-tier direct-to-DVD martial arts film that delivers exactly what fans want: brutal, well-choreographed fights and a likable, unbeatable hero. It’s not high art, but it’s among the best in its class. Recommended for action enthusiasts and Michael Jai White completists.
